What is Recuperáveis de Resseguro?
In this glossary, Recuperáveis de Resseguro refers to: The amount of paid or unpaid claims and claim adjustment expenses that an insurer is entitled to recover from reinsurers under reinsurance contracts.
How is Recuperáveis de Resseguro used in finance?
In finance communication, this term appears in contexts such as: "A seguradora relatou recuperáveis de resseguro como ativo em seu balanço, aguardando liquidação dos resseguradores."
